The Science of Sleep

Sleep is divided into two primary states: non-rapid eye movement (NREM) and rapid eye movement (REM) sleep. Together, these states form cycles that repeat throughout the night:

  • NREM Sleep: Comprising three stages, this phase is when the body repairs tissues, strengthens the immune system, and consolidates memories.
  • REM Sleep: Often associated with dreaming, REM sleep supports brain function, creativity, and emotional processing.

On average, adults need 7–9 hours of sleep per night to complete these cycles and reap their full benefits.

Common Sleep Disorders and Their Impact

Millions of people struggle with sleep disorders that affect their health and quality of life. Common conditions include:

1. Insomnia

Characterized by difficulty falling or staying asleep, insomnia can lead to fatigue, poor concentration, and mood disturbances.

2. Sleep Apnea

Sleep apnea causes interruptions in breathing during sleep, leading to fragmented rest and increased risk of heart disease.

3. Restless Leg Syndrome (RLS)

RLS involves uncomfortable sensations in the legs, often disrupting sleep. It’s linked to conditions like iron deficiency and neurological disorders.

4. Narcolepsy

This neurological disorder causes excessive daytime sleepiness and sudden sleep attacks, affecting daily functioning.

Types of Business Partnerships

Understanding the different types of partnerships can help you identify the best approach for your business:

1. Strategic Alliances

Strategic alliances involve two businesses working together to achieve shared objectives without merging operations. For example, a software company partnering with a hardware manufacturer to create a bundled solution for customers.

2. Co-Marketing Partnerships

In a co-marketing partnership, businesses collaborate on joint promotional efforts, such as webinars, content campaigns, or shared advertising. This approach allows partners to pool resources and reach a wider audience.

3. Supply Chain Partnerships

These partnerships streamline operations by aligning with suppliers or distributors. By fostering close relationships, businesses can ensure consistent quality, reduce costs, and improve delivery times.

4. Affiliate Partnerships

Affiliate partnerships involve one business promoting another’s products or services in exchange for a commission. This model is common in e-commerce and digital marketing.

5. Joint Ventures

In a joint venture, two businesses create a new entity to achieve specific goals. This type of partnership often involves shared investments, risks, and rewards.

Examples of Successful Business Partnerships

Many well-known companies have achieved remarkable success through partnerships:

1. Starbucks and Spotify

Starbucks partnered with Spotify to enhance the in-store experience for customers. The collaboration allowed Starbucks employees to curate playlists while promoting Spotify’s services to a broader audience.

2. Apple and Nike

Apple and Nike joined forces to integrate fitness tracking technology into Nike products, resulting in the popular Nike+ line. This partnership combined Apple’s tech expertise with Nike’s athletic brand appeal.

3. Uber and Spotify

Uber and Spotify collaborated to allow riders to control the music during their rides. This unique feature enhanced the customer experience for both platforms.

Start with Smart Planning

Planning is essential when creating a sustainable garden. Begin by assessing your space, understanding the soil type, and observing the natural sunlight patterns. These factors will determine the types of plants that will thrive in your garden.

Consider planting native species, as they are naturally adapted to your region’s climate and require less water and maintenance. Group plants with similar water and sunlight needs together to optimize irrigation and energy use.

Create a layout that includes a mix of edible plants, flowers, and shrubs to ensure biodiversity. Incorporating layers—ground cover, mid-level plants, and taller trees—can mimic natural ecosystems and provide habitats for various species.

Use Water Wisely

Water conservation is a cornerstone of sustainable gardening. Install a rainwater harvesting system to collect and reuse water for irrigation. Drip irrigation systems are another efficient option, as they deliver water directly to the roots, minimizing waste.

Mulching around plants helps retain soil moisture and reduce the need for frequent watering. Choose drought-tolerant plants for areas with limited water resources, and water your garden early in the morning or late in the evening to minimize evaporation.

Prioritize Soil Health

Healthy soil is the foundation of a thriving garden. Avoid chemical fertilizers and pesticides, which can harm beneficial organisms and leach into water supplies. Instead, opt for organic compost and natural soil amendments.

Composting kitchen scraps and garden waste is an excellent way to enrich your soil with nutrients while reducing waste. Worm composting, or vermiculture, is another effective method to enhance soil quality.

Practice crop rotation in edible gardens to prevent soil depletion and encourage nutrient cycling. Planting cover crops during off-seasons can also improve soil structure and fertility.

Attract Pollinators and Wildlife

A sustainable garden should support local wildlife, including pollinators like bees and butterflies. Include plants that bloom throughout the year to provide a consistent food source for pollinators.

Adding features like birdhouses, bee hotels, and small water sources can attract beneficial wildlife. Avoid using pesticides, as they can harm not only pests but also helpful creatures like ladybugs and earthworms.

Create a balanced ecosystem by encouraging natural predators to control pests. For instance, birds and frogs can help keep insect populations in check.

Incorporate Recycled and Upcycled Materials

Sustainability extends beyond plants and soil. Use recycled or upcycled materials in your garden for decor, pathways, or even plant containers. Old wooden pallets can be turned into planters, and broken pots can serve as creative edging for garden beds.

Consider using reclaimed bricks or stones for pathways and borders. Not only do these materials add character, but they also reduce the demand for new resources.

Maintain Your Garden Sustainably

Once your garden is established, maintaining it sustainably ensures its long-term success. Regularly weed by hand to avoid chemical herbicides. Prune plants to encourage healthy growth and remove diseased parts to prevent spread.

Use tools like push lawnmowers instead of gas-powered ones to reduce emissions. Additionally, practice seasonal planting to make the most of your garden’s natural cycles.
